i am now in the process of choosing a suitable linear regulator for my project which is a RF LED Dot Matrix Display. My LED Board has input requirements of 5V and 2.4A.

I actually intended to use the LM2678 switching regulator because of high efficiency for the project but my supervisor said that it would be too highly efficient for a simple LED board like that..(like using a whole power station to power one single light bulb) and the cost would be excessive ( converted from my country's currency, the regulator will cost approximately $5 which is kinda high for my supervisor) and so I am now searching for a suitable linear regulator.

I would really appreciate if anyone could recommend me any linear regulator (as well as the link to its datasheet ) suitable for my project which is cheap and meets my project input requirements.

Thank you.
 
You haven't said what the input voltage is.

If it's mains, the cheapest option is to buy a 5V regulated wall plug power supply.

Assuming the price is in US $, you'll have a hard time finding a mains powered 5V 2.4A supply for $5 even if purchased in large quantities.
